Abstract

Warehouse management has evolved from a traditional storage function into a strategic component that contributes significantly to overall supply chain performance. This article examines the role of strategic warehouse management in responding to a changing business environment characterised by increasing operational complexity, technological advancement, changing customer expectations, supply chain disruptions, and growing sustainability concerns. The article adopts a conceptual approach by reviewing and synthesising existing literature related to warehouse operations, digital technologies, supply chain integration, resilience, and sustainable warehouse management. The analysis identifies several major challenges, including inefficient warehouse processes, difficulties in technology adoption, fragmented information and coordination, complex customer fulfilment requirements, and increasing exposure to supply chain disruptions. Particular attention is given to digitalisation, automation, Internet of Things technologies, and Industry 4.0 as important developments that can strengthen warehouse visibility, accuracy, connectivity, and responsiveness. The article also emphasises that effective warehouse performance depends on stronger integration between warehouse activities and other supply chain functions. Furthermore, resilience and environmental sustainability are identified as essential considerations for maintaining long term supply chain performance under uncertain business conditions. Strategic recommendations include integrated warehouse planning, balanced performance measurement, appropriate technology adoption, stronger information sharing, improved supply chain coordination, flexible fulfilment capabilities, and environmentally responsible warehouse practices. Overall, strategic warehouse management can strengthen operational efficiency, responsiveness, resilience, and sustainable supply chain performance when warehouse resources and capabilities are effectively aligned with broader organisational and supply chain objectives.
